USGS Streamgage 06354580
Beaver Creek below Linton, ND
Beaver Creek below Linton, ND is USGS streamgage 06354580, monitoring river discharge in hydrologic subbasin 10130104. It drains a watershed of about 765 square miles. Discharge records at this site go back to 1989. Typical flow runs near 22.3 cfs in July and 85.4 cfs in April, with the higher of the two arriving in April.

Typical flow by month
Long-term daily discharge percentiles from the USGS record (up to 37 years of data), averaged within each month. These describe the historical normal range — they are not a forecast and not today's reading.
| Month | Low p10 | Typical p50 | High p90 | Range |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| January | 1.2 | 8.1 | 18.3 | |
| February | 1.3 | 10.6 | 74 | |
| March | 7 | 49.9 | 627.1 | |
| April | 14.9 | 85.4 | 763.3 | |
| May | 11.7 | 65.1 | 229.6 | |
| June | 5.1 | 36.4 | 120.9 | |
| July | 2.1 | 22.3 | 157.4 | |
| August | 0.8 | 11.1 | 66.2 | |
| September | 0.5 | 8.5 | 44.6 | |
| October | 1.7 | 10.1 | 37.9 | |
| November | 3.3 | 13 | 37.3 | |
| December | 1.9 | 9.8 | 28.7 |
All values in cubic feet per second (cfs).
